Rule 15. Disposition of Exhibits
Subject to the provisions of Rule 28, Rules of Criminal Procedure, all exhibits admitted in evidence or marked for identification may be disposed of after ninety days from the conclusion of a case by judgment, order or other final disposition, or by mandate on appeal, as follows:
(3) If counsel or the parties do not present themselves to the clerk to accept delivery of exhibits, or if the notice is returned undelivered, and if no order of retention is made, the clerk shall retain the exhibits for an additional sixty days from the date of the notice previously sent, and shall thereafter dispose of said exhibits as directed by the judge who heard the case, or if unavailable, the presiding judge.
